The consumer unit, commonly referred to as a fuse box or electrical panel, is the cornerstone of a home’s electrical system. It manages the distribution of electricity from the main supply to all circuits in the property while protecting against overloads, short circuits, and other electrical faults. Over time, consumer units can become outdated, unsafe, or insufficient to meet modern electrical demands. Replacing a consumer unit is not merely a technical upgrade; it is a vital step to ensure safety, reliability, and efficiency in any household.
One of the most compelling reasons for a consumer unit replacements is safety. Older units, especially those installed decades ago, often lack modern protective devices such as residual current devices (RCDs) and modern circuit breakers. RCDs are essential safety mechanisms that detect faults in electrical circuits and cut off the electricity supply almost instantly, preventing electric shocks and reducing the risk of fire. Traditional fuse-based systems, common in older homes, provide minimal protection compared to modern units and are often incompatible with today’s electrical appliances. By upgrading to a modern consumer unit, homeowners can significantly enhance safety for both their family and property.
Capacity is another critical factor driving consumer unit replacements. As households accumulate more appliances, gadgets, and heating or cooling systems, the demand on the electrical system increases. Older consumer units may lack sufficient circuits or the necessary amperage to support these additional loads. This can lead to frequent tripping, overloaded circuits, and even damage to electrical devices. A modern unit can accommodate more circuits, higher-rated breakers, and dedicated lines for high-demand appliances, ensuring the system can handle contemporary usage efficiently. This is especially relevant for homes that have undergone extensions, renovations, or conversions, where the electrical load is likely to have increased substantially.
Efficiency and convenience also play a significant role in the decision to replace a consumer unit. Modern panels are designed for easier management, clearer labeling of circuits, and quicker troubleshooting in case of faults. Circuit breakers can be reset swiftly, eliminating the inconvenience of replacing fuses or dealing with frequent outages. Additionally, some advanced units come with smart features, allowing homeowners to monitor energy consumption, detect faults remotely, and even control circuits via mobile applications. These capabilities not only improve convenience but also encourage energy efficiency, helping households reduce electricity bills while maintaining safety.
It is important to note that replacing a consumer unit is not a task for untrained individuals. The work involves handling high-voltage electricity, and incorrect installation can have severe consequences, including fire, electrocution, or property damage. A certified electrician will assess the existing system, determine the appropriate replacement unit, and carry out the installation according to current electrical regulations. Proper installation includes correct earthing, secure connections, and thorough testing of all protective devices. After completion, professional certification or inspection ensures compliance with safety standards and provides homeowners with peace of mind.
Future-proofing is another essential consideration during a consumer unit replacement. Electrical needs continue to evolve with the adoption of renewable energy systems, electric vehicles, and smart home technologies. Investing in a consumer unit with spare capacity and flexibility allows homeowners to add circuits, integrate solar panels, or support electric vehicle chargers without requiring a complete overhaul in the future. Planning for future demands ensures that the electrical system remains reliable, safe, and capable of accommodating technological advancements.
Consumer unit replacements also improve the overall reliability of a home’s electrical system. Modern units reduce the risk of nuisance trips and provide more precise protection for sensitive appliances. By dividing circuits effectively and using advanced breakers, electricity can be distributed more evenly, minimizing downtime and enhancing the longevity of connected devices. This ensures that critical systems, such as heating, refrigeration, and security, continue to function smoothly.
